Stratford and District Christian School Society is a charitable organization based in Stratford, Ontario, classified by the CRA under teaching institutions. It appears on the charity register the way hospitals, universities, and other publicly funded bodies do — to issue tax receipts — rather than as a donation-driven charity in the usual sense. In its fiscal year ending August 31, 2024, it reported $1.1M in revenue and $1.1M in expenditures.

Its funding that year was roughly 36% from donations. In 2024, 5 other registered charities reported granting it a combined $4,914.

Compared with 1,247 education institutions of similar size, its share of spending on mission — charitable programs plus grants to other charities — ranked above 60% of peers. Its fundraising cost per donated dollar was lower than 85% of that peer group. Its reserves, measured in years of spending on hand, sat in the top decile of the group. Its highest-paid positions fell in the $80,000–119,999 range (4 positions in that band). The charity reported 6 permanent full-time positions.

It reported gifts to 2 qualified donees totalling $1,939 in 2024, the largest being $1,172 to The Terry Fox Foundation. Its filed list of directors and trustees shows 8 names.

In its own words

The charity runs a day school JK to Grade 8 where every subject is taught with a Christian perspective.

Ongoing-program description from its T3010 filing, verbatim.
